A beefed up AT&T unveiled a new unlimited calling plan it hopes will quell cable’s VoIP growth. The "AT&T Unity" plan begins Sun offering subs free domestic calls to/from any AT&T wireless and wireline phone numbers. The telco dubs it "a calling community of more than 100mln." Residential and business subs would qualify for the plan, which will run at least $110/month, if they order a bundling of AT&T wireless service and unlimited local and long distance wireline services.
